Factoring using the AC method (Factor by Grouping)


Here is another way to factor quadratics. This solver will show you how to factor any quadratic by grouping.


Enter integer (whole number) coefficients of the quadratic in the form ax^2+bx+c where c must not equal zero. For instance, to factor the quadratic 2x^2+8x+6, let a=2, b=8, and c=6.
